Digital India & Data Policy: Interview-Ready Analytics Implications
A tea seller accepts a UPI payment, the customer opens DigiLocker for KYC at a bank kiosk, and a delivery app recalculates the next rider route before the receipt is printed. That is Digital India in plain sight - not just apps, but a data-producing public infrastructure where policy decides what analytics teams can collect, combine, model and explain.
- Digital India creates digital rails - identity, payments, documents, connectivity and platforms - that make large-scale analytics possible.
- Data policy decides the boundaries: consent, purpose limitation, data minimisation, security safeguards, retention and grievance handling.
- India Stack is the practical analytics engine: Aadhaar-enabled identity, UPI payments, DigiLocker documents, Account Aggregator consented financial data and similar rails.
- DPDP Act, 2023 shifts analytics from βcan we capture this?β to βdo we have a lawful purpose, consent trail and responsible data use?β
- Good analytics work now needs three layers: business question, data governance and model output. Missing the governance layer is the fastest way to sound shallow.
- The strongest interview answers connect policy to decisions: credit scoring, fraud detection, customer segmentation, public service delivery and risk control.
- The common trap: treating Digital India as a government scheme only. For analytics, it is a market-wide data infrastructure plus a compliance operating model.

Definitions You Should Be Able to Say Cleanly
- Digital India - MeitY: βA flagship programme of the Government of India with a vision to transform India into a digitally empowered society and knowledge economy.β
- Personal data - DPDP Act, 2023: βAny data about an individual who is identifiable by or in relation to such data.β
- Data fiduciary - DPDP Act, 2023: βAny person who alone or in conjunction with other persons determines the purpose and means of processing of personal data.β
- Analytics: The structured use of data, statistics and models to generate insights for better decisions.
Real Example: Account Aggregator Changes Credit Analytics
Indiaβs Account Aggregator framework allows consent-based sharing of financial information between regulated financial institutions and approved financial information users. For analytics teams in lending, this can improve underwriting because bank statement patterns, cash flows and repayment behaviour can be evaluated with user consent instead of relying only on uploaded PDFs or thin bureau files.
The strategic βso whatβ: the primary driver is consented access to verified financial data. Supporting drivers are standardised data flows, reduced document friction, better fraud checks and clearer auditability. That combination changes credit analytics from document collection to governed data interpretation.
Case Study: Lendingkart and Digital MSME Credit Analytics
Lendingkart built its MSME lending proposition around digital data-led credit assessment, showing how Digital India rails can expand analytics-driven finance beyond traditional collateral-heavy lending.

Situation: Many Indian micro, small and medium enterprises need working capital but may not have the long formal credit history, collateral depth or branch-heavy documentation that traditional underwriting prefers. At the same time, business activity is increasingly digital - payments, invoices, bank transactions, GST-linked records and online commerce footprints.
The move: Lendingkart used a digital-first lending model where analytics evaluates alternative and formal data signals to assess MSME creditworthiness. The important point is not βmore dataβ by itself. The primary driver is cash-flow-oriented digital underwriting. Supporting drivers include faster digital journeys, automated risk rules, document digitisation, bureau inputs, fraud checks and a scalable technology platform.
Outcome and lesson: The lesson is that Digital India makes new analytics products possible, but data policy decides whether they are sustainable. A fintech cannot simply scrape or hoard every available signal. It must prove lawful collection, user consent where required, secure processing, fair lending logic and auditable decisions - especially because credit denial or pricing directly affects customers.
A shallow answer says, βDigital India gives fintechs more data.β A strong answer says, βDigital India creates verified digital rails, while data policy forces fintech analytics to become consent-led, explainable and risk-controlled.β
